  • Patent number: 8329292
    Abstract: A method of using an absorbent article where the method includes adhering at least a portion of an absorbent article to a surface of a window through a pressure sensitive adhesive composition. The absorbent article includes an exterior surface, an acquisition layer, superabsorbent polymer, a first layer that has an exterior surface and an interior surface, and a pressure sensitive attachment adhesive composition, the superabsorbent polymer being disposed between the acquisition layer and the interior surface of the first layer, and the pressure sensitive attachment adhesive composition being disposed on the exterior surface of the absorbent article.

  • Patent number: 4984865
    Abstract: An optical fiber connector can be easily and quickly assembled by mounting the end of an optical fiber in a thermoplastic adhesive that is heated to a viscosity of between 1000 and 10,000 cp, has an Adhesion-to-Glass Value of at least 10N, and a Shore D hardness of at least 60 at 20.degree. C. The optical fiber connector lends itself to mass-production techniques and can be reused by heating to liquify the thermoplastic adhesive.
